Seen and heard in Salt Lake City: On 'hot and sweaty' Valentine's Day cards, bad birthdays

  • Bruce Pascoe
  • Feb 15, 2019
  • Feb 15, 2019 Updated Feb 17, 2019

Bruce Pascoe checks in with the sights and sounds from Huntsman Center in Salt Lake City, where Utah handed the Arizona Wildcats their sixth straight loss Thursday night, 83-76.

High expectations

Arizona Utah Basketball (copy)

Utah coach Larry Krystkowiak yells to players during the first half of the team's NCAA college basketball game against Arizona on Thursday, Feb. 14, 2019, in Salt Lake City.

Alex Goodlett / AP Photo

Then again, maybe some of the fans absence had something to do with expectations that arent quite being met.

Although Utah has exceeded or been tied with its preseason prediction in the Pac-12 preseason media poll every year since 2011-12 and are on pace this season to do so again, after being picked eighth Deseret 做厙勛圖 columnist Brad Rock wrote this week that Ute fan expectations are an entirely different matter.

Coach Larry Krystkowiak has the nations eighth-highest salary among college basketball coaches, $3.39 million, according to USA Today. In a column entitled, Krystkowiaks cliff act not a fireable offense, Rock wrote that Rabid fans say Utah is underperforming, and based on Krystkos princely salary, its true.

But Rock also said Krystkowiak has done well with the recruits he has been able to land, and that his teams have finished respectably in the standings.

The Pac-12 had more players (69) on opening-day NBA rosters this year than any other conference except the ACC (82), and more than twice that of the highly rated Big East (31), Rock wrote. Yet the Utes consistently finish in the top third of the league standings.

Harlans homecoming of sorts

Mark Harlan

Mark Harlan

Utah Athletics

Having started his athletics career as a graduate assistant for Dick Tomeys Arizona football teams in the mid-1990s, Mark Harlan took in his first home game between Arizona and Utah as the Utes athletic director.

Harlan worked at UA in a variety of roles early in his career, while also stopping at San Jose State and Northern Colorado, and then left Arizona to become UCLAs senior associate AD for external relations in 2010.

From there, Harlan served as South Floridas AD from 2014 until he was hired in the same role at Utah in June 2018.

After all that traveling, Harlan said it still felt surreal to be facing an Arizona team.

Its a special place, Harlan said of UA. Theres a lot of special people there.

Red eye

Arizona Utah Basketball (copy)

Arizona coach Sean Miller yells to players during the first half of an NCAA college basketball game against Utah on Thursday, Feb. 14, 2019, in Salt Lake City.

Alex Goodlett / AP Photo

Eventhough the Wildcats wont play Colorado until Sunday, they were scheduled to take a charter flight to the Denver area immediately after Thursdays game.

Ryan Reynolds, UAs director of basketball operations, said the decision to move quickly came about because the school was paying charter operator Sun Country to have the plane that took them from 做厙勛圖 to Salt Lake City on Wednesday sit around before the flight to Denver.

The good news for the Wildcats is that their flight, for a change, could actually land at Rocky Mountain Metropolitan Airport, in Broomfield, just 13 miles from their Boulder hotel.
